# Ledgerpine Admin — Environments

Dark mode in the Ledgerpine admin dashboard is controlled per environment, not per user. Staging forces dark mode on so contrast regressions surface early; production honors the tenant default. Theme tokens live in the Umberline package and are compiled at deploy, so a flag flip requires a redeploy. Do not toggle themes via the browser console — state won't persist and QA screenshots will mismatch. Each environment reads its theme settings from the block below.

settings of tagef-bawif:
DRUIX_HOST=druix.zemvarlabs.internal
DRUIX_PORT=8000

Root cause: our 3.2 release changed the default font-metric stub used during snapshot rendering, so every baseline image shifted by two pixels. Plugin authors: this was not a fault in your components. We have restored the old stub behind a compatibility flag and regenerated the canonical baselines. If your pipeline pinned our renderer, rebaseline against the restored stub. The corrected renderer build is identified by the token below.

session token of kawip-yajeg = htk6_209e95

### Rendering invoices

The Paperwhistle renderer takes a JSON invoice body and spits back a PDF, usually in under a second. POST to /v2/render with the template slug and line items; fonts are baked in, so don't bother uploading any. Heads up: malformed currency codes fail silently with a blank page — validate first. Every request needs auth, so include the bearer token below.

login token, bagug-kafop: eyJhbGciOiJIUzI1NiIsInR5cCI6IkpXVCJ9.eyJzdWIiOiIcMLov2In0.Z5RLDIfp